Arsenal vs Chelsea: 5 players to watch out for | Premier League 2020-21
Jong Ching Yee FOLLOW ANALYST Modified 26 Dec 2020, 01:07 IST Top 5 / Top 10 SHARE Advertisement Plenty of things have changed since Arsenal beat Chelsea in the FA Cup last season. The Blues are currently fifth in the 2020-21 Premier League table, with two wins in five games, while the Gunners are rooted in 15th place and without a victory in seven matches. The London Derby will be played behind closed doors, but Frank Lampard's side start off as the favourites. That is because, their poor form apart, Arsenal are going through tough times, with eyebrows being raised over their transfer signings and on-field discipline.
